Above average case from Antec

4

This case has four fans! It's build quality is as expected with Antec, and I love how its lighted up with blue leds on top and front. Only sad thing is theres no window on the side, but that's not really imporant at all. The air flow is great, with fans in front sucking on the air and the rear ones blowing outwards, the flow is good in the computer. I don't really like the fact that there is a fan up top because dust can fall in when the computer is not on, but oh wells. Plenty of space in the case itself, easily fits the motherboard compared to some other cases I've used. The front side also has a airfilter that traps dust and can be machine washed, A great addition, just wish that they had bothered to have that for the side and top holes too. Plenty of space for additional raid harddrives and comes with a dock for 2.5" SDD on the bottom of the case. Small qualm with the Power button being hard to find in the dark, no lights up top to let you see it when the plug is in but the CPU is not on.

well constructed

5

The 300 illusion is basically the same as the Antec 300 but it's got some nice twists involved. The twists are mainly form factor. There is a 140mm fan (very large) on the top of the 300 illusion and it's got blue leds mounted to them which gives it a nice glow. The two front 120mm fans are also blue lit which is nice. All the fans on the 300 illusion are 3 speeds. There is low speed, medium speed, and high speed. Depending on what you need you can set the fans up accordingly. You will get better cooler with max settings obviously but you will sacrifice on silence and noise. The Antec 300 illusion weighs almost 16 lbs, which makes it neither light or heavy. Just like the Antec 300, theres a perforated front grill in the front which makes cleaning the dust that gets into your case really simple. This is a mid tower so the 300 illusion isn't enormous like a Corsair obsidian. I really like the size of the 300 illusion and I'm very glad that Antec built it. I'm hopeful for a second edition.

Good Antec

4

I got my Antec 300 illusion in a bundled deal from newegg. It came with some DDR3 memory. This is my first Antec case and I am very happy with their quality. The outside looks really nice and isn't overly done. When you turn off the lights or dim the lights down a bit you allow the blue lights to really shine and it gives a nice feel to your room to have some illumination. My harddrives and my graphics card fit in the Antec 300 illusion without any bumping or without me having to file anything down. The power supply fit in with no issues as well. This thing seems to have a lot of ventilation which is good since graphics cards can really heat up the insides of a case if you have the card running hard. Two hours of playing Modern Warfare for example can get my case heated up pretty well since my card runs hot. But with the fans on medium setting, the Antec 300 illusion doesn't seem to have much problems with the heat from my graphics card.

Pretty cool case

5

The Antec three hundred illusion black steel ATX Mid Tower computer case is an awesome case that will meet all your needs, granted that you have a micro ATX motherboard. A full length tower is needed for a full length motherboard, as this is really designed for a micro ATX board. It's an extremely professional, very elegeant case. There is no unnecessary features on the exterior of the case. Now to be frank, I do not like the blue LED fans and if you also do not like these fans, you can simply swap them out with fans that have no lighting, or better yet, just simply get the Antec 300 micro atx case. The 300 Illusion is different really only due to the different fans. They are pretty identical other than that. So that case comes with 3 optical drive slots, a dust filter in the front, and has plenty of ventilation inside, with one fan on the top, on in the rear, and one on the side. The two things that i dislike about this antec case is the aforementioned fan lighting, and the fact that the inside of the antec 300 case is not painted and is bare metal (grey).
